Download Train Station 2 | Train Station 2: Play Now
SponsoredDownload Train Station 2 Game and Install Train Station 2 for Free. Train Station 2 …Types: Games, Communication, Social, Music, Tools, Photography, Shopping, DatingDownload Free PC Games | Free Games for Your PC
SponsoredAll your favorite games—arcade, fighting, simulator—in one free extension. No sign …Types: Arcade, Word, Puzzle, Strategy, Shooting, Zombie, Action/Adventure

Feedback